Find the greatest number which will divide 42, 49 and 56 and leave remainders 6, 7 and 8 respectively

A

6

B

8

C

12

D

24

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To solve the problem of finding the greatest number that divides 42, 49, and 56 while leaving remainders of 6, 7, and 8 respectively, we can follow these steps: ### Step 1: Adjust the numbers by subtracting the remainders To find the number that divides the given numbers leaving specific remainders, we first subtract the remainders from each of the numbers. - For 42, subtract 6: \( 42 - 6 = 36 \) - For 49, subtract 7: \( 49 - 7 = 42 \) - For 56, subtract 8: \( 56 - 8 = 48 \) Now we have the adjusted numbers: 36, 42, and 48. ### Step 2: Find the HCF of the adjusted numbers Next, we need to find the highest common factor (HCF) of the adjusted numbers: 36, 42, and 48. **Finding the HCF:** 1. **Prime factorization of each number:** - 36: \( 2^2 \times 3^2 \) - 42: \( 2^1 \times 3^1 \times 7^1 \) - 48: \( 2^4 \times 3^1 \) 2. **Identify the common prime factors:** - The common prime factors are 2 and 3. 3. **Take the lowest power of each common factor:** - For 2: The lowest power is \( 2^1 \). - For 3: The lowest power is \( 3^1 \). 4. **Calculate the HCF:** \[ HCF = 2^1 \times 3^1 = 2 \times 3 = 6 \] ### Step 3: Conclusion The greatest number that will divide 42, 49, and 56 and leave remainders of 6, 7, and 8 respectively is **6**. ---
